The Corps Commander of Amotekun in Ogun State, Brig. Gen. A.I. Adedigba (rtd), has dismissed claims by online news platform Sahara Reporters that the state security outfit is underfunded by the Dapo Abiodun-led administration.

Describing the report as “malicious, misleading, and lacking in substance,” Adedigba asserted that Amotekun remains a critical component of the state’s security architecture and has received significant support from the government.

“Governor Abiodun was one of the first governors to inaugurate and empower Amotekun in his state,” he said.

“He has not only prioritized the security of Ogun residents but has also provided essential resources, including 10 brand new Toyota Hilux patrol vehicles, to boost our operations.”

Refuting the claim that only ₦103 million was allocated to Amotekun in 2024, the Commander stated, “The actual figure stands at ₦731,770,793.53. In fact, for 2025, the Ogun State House of Assembly has approved an increase in our budget to ₦1.5 billion.”

He further highlighted the administration’s commitment by citing the construction of a new state headquarters, the renovation of the old secretariat office, and the drilling of a borehole to address water challenges.

He also noted that the government had recruited and trained an additional 750 personnel in 2024, covering their salaries from the first day in camp.

“In addition to this, Governor Abiodun recently approved another batch of 500 operatives, providing them with full kits and ensuring their salaries are cash-backed. How can anyone claim that Amotekun is neglected?” he questioned.

Adedigba emphasized that Amotekun’s operational capacity has improved through government-funded training programs, workshops, and intelligence-sharing collaborations with other security agencies.

“Just two weeks ago, the Governor handed over additional operational vehicles and power bikes to us, bringing our fleet to over 45 serviceable vehicles and 70 motorcycles. These investments show the government’s unwavering dedication to securing Ogun State,” he added.

He urged the public to disregard misleading reports and seek accurate information from verified sources.

“The government remains committed to transparency and accountability. All budget documents and allocations are publicly accessible for scrutiny,” Adedigba concluded.
